Pine Mountain Firefighters Busy During Christmas Season


More Pictures HERE - View Video HERE

Firefighters in Pine Mountain kept busy during the Christmas Season, but not as a result of emergency calls.

In fact, the number of emergency calls was down as compared to previous years but firefighters were kept busy in a number of Christmas-related activities.

The season began in November with Light Up Pine Mountain. During the celebration, Pine Mountain Mayor Joey Teel officially lit the town’s Christmas Tree. The Pine Mountain Fire Department delivered Santa Claus to the event, to the delight of children and adults.

On Saturday, December 3, Pine Mountain firefighters participated in three parades. The first parade took place in Pine Mountain with Santa Claus riding on top of Quint 1201. Later that evening, Quint 1201 participated in the Hamilton Christmas Parade while Sparky the Fire Dog and Squad 12 were featured in the Manchester Christmas Parade.

The final Christmas event took place on evening of Christmas Eve. For the 15th year, Pine Mountain firefighters towed Santa and his sleigh along every street in town with firefighters distributing candy canes to all the children that came out to see Santa.

With his reindeer preparing for their long trip, Santa’s sleigh was towed around town by Pine Mountain Fire Department’s Ranger unit with Squad 12 and Engine 1202 trailing.

Though a busy season, the Christmas season is always a fun time for Pine Mountain’s firefighters.
